New and noteworthy
New Rule Designer
Thanks to Clément Fournier, we now have a new rule designer GUI, which is based on JavaFX. It replaces the old designer and can be started via
bin/run.sh designer(on Unix-like platform such as Linux and Mac OS X)bin\designer.bat(on Windows)Note: At least Java8 is required for the designer. The old designer is still available as
designeroldbut will be removed with the next major release.Java 9 support
The Java grammar has been updated to support analyzing Java 9 projects:
- private methods in interfaces are possible
 - The underscore "_" is considered an invalid identifier
